There are few reports of oxidative addition of metallic transition metals under mild conditions [120] two reports involving group 8 elements have appeared. Fischer and Burger reported the preparation of the n -allylpalladium complex by the reaction of a palladium sponge with allyl bromide [121]. The Grignard-type reaction addition of allyl haUdes to aldehydes has been carried out by reacting allylic halides with cobalt or nickel metal prepared by reduction of cobalt or nickel halides with manganese/iron alloy thiourea [122]. [Pg.285]

The allylation of imines with allylindium reagents in organic solvents gives the corresponding homoallylic amines.251-253 Under solvent-free conditions, the indium-mediated reaction of iV-benzylideneaniline furnishes a mixture of mono-allylated 79 and bis-allylated products 80 (Equation (56)). The bis-allylated product 80 presumably arises via a formation of an iminium salt, which is subsequently attacked by the allylindium nucleophiles. Formation of 80 is entirely suppressed by addition of allyl bromide to indium metal prior to any addition of the imine (Grignard-type reaction).254... [Pg.687]

Stereoselective catalysis in zeolites is still one of the ultimate goals in zeolite science. Earlier work in this field was summarized recently [4]. More recently, Mahrwald et al. [95] reported that the addition of aluminophosphate molecular sieves in the liquid phase alkylation of a-chiral benzaldehydes by butyllithium results in an increased proportion of the so-called Cram product in the diastereomeric mixture. It is argued that in this Grignard type reaction the adsorption of the reactants on the molecular sieves favors the attack at the sterically less hindered position of the molecule. This shape selectivity effect is even observed when the reactant is adsorbed at the outer crystal surface, as demonstrated for the case of the small-pore AIPO4-I7. [Pg.371]

Recently Yamamoto reported Pd-catalyzed intramolecular nucleophilic addition of the arylpalladium bromide 72 formed from 71 to ketone to give the alcohol 73 using PCy3 as a ligand and an excess of 1-hexanol. This is the first example of a Pd-catalyzed Grignard-type reaction [46],... [Pg.21]

Furthermore, as a related reaction, they obtained the cyclopentanol 79 by the Grignard-type reaction of l-methyl-2-(o-bromophenyl)ethyl phenyl ketone (78) without alkynes in the presence of Pd(OAc)2, PCy3, Na2C03 and 1-hexanol. It was confirmed that the addition of 1-hexanol was crucial [26]. These reactions are mechanistically interesting. A similar catalytic reaction has been reported by Vieente. These reactions are considered again in Chapter 3.7.2 [27]. [Pg.242]

For the mechanism of the metal-mediated Grignard-type reactions in water, Li previously proposed a carbanion/allylmetal/radical triad, in which the specific mechanism of the reaction is dependent on the metal being used (Fig. 4.6). Recently, mechanistic studies of the aUylation detected secondary deuterium kinetic isotope effects in the metal-mediated aUylation ofbenzaldehyde in aqueous media.The inverse SDKIE observed for the indium and tin cases are consistent with the polar addition mechanism. For magnesium and antimony, normal SDKIE were observed. These were interpreted as single electron transfer processes on metal surface in the magnesium case, or between the allyhnetal and the carbonyl compound in the antimony case. [Pg.113]

The development of the Grignard-type addition to carbonyl compounds mediated by transition metals would be of interest as the compatibility with a variety of functionality would be expected under the reaction conditions employed. One example has been reported on the addition of allyl halides to aldehydes in the presence of cobalt or nickel metal however, yields were low (up to 22%). Benzylic nickel halides prepared in situ by the oxidative addition of benzyl halides to metallic nickel were found to add to benzil and give the corresponding 3-hydroxyketones in high yields(46). The reaction appears to be quite general and will tolerate a wide range of functionality. [Pg.233]

Vinylchromium compounds (12,137).6 These compounds can be obtained by reaction of vinyl triflates with CrCl2 catalyzed by NiCl2 in DMF. They undergo selective Grignard-type addition to aldehydes. Some commercial sources of CrCl2 do not require a catalyst, presumably because they contain a metal contaminant. [Pg.96]
